#54db0d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#54db0d is composed of 32.9% red, 85.9%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 94.1%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 99.3 degrees, a saturation of 88.8% and a lightness of 45.5%. #54db0d color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ff1a with #00b700.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

#54db0d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#54db0d has RGB values of R:84, G:219,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0, Y:0.94,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 5561101.

Shades and Tints of #54db0d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060f01 is the darkest color, while #fdfff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#54db0d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#72796f is the less saturated color, while #51e404 is the most saturated one.
